I was initially very excited about this light to use when my wife and I are riding together to help us signal to whichever one of us is behind that the one of us in front is slowing down. However, we discovered that on anything but super smooth, flat roads the light went into the super bright warning mode extremely frequently. After a few rides, one of the two lights pretty much stays in this mode constantly and eats up its battery in the process. I have given up on these lights and bought different lights instead.
